You asked, is Paris Marathon a fast course? Course – The course is very flat, definitely a race to get a PR. There is some cobblestone, but I wear Hoka’s so didn’t notice it much. If you wear more of a racing flat, you’ll feel them. The last 4 miles have some slight inclines.

You asked, is Paris Marathon flat? The marathon course may be mostly flat, but it presents a few tricky obstacles and unusual surprises for the unwary: … Cobblestones – Modern Paris really does not have vast numbers of cobblestone streets – but you’ll encounter more than your share along the marathon course, especially early in the race.

What time does Paris Marathon start?

Start Time : 8:45 a.m. The Paris Marathon is one of the most popular marathons in Europe. A scenic race through a beautiful city, passing many iconic sights.

How long does it take to run a marathon?

The global average time for a marathon stands at around 4 hours 21 minutes – with men’s average times at 4 hours 13 minutes, and women at 4 hours 42 minutes.

Which is harder NYC or Boston Marathon?

New York is brutal. Queensboro (uphill) bridge and rolling hills at the very end in central park. Boston has 4 moderately difficult hills between mile 16 and 20.8 (heartbreak hill) but overall the rest of the marathon is a net 500+ feet downhill. Slightly less difficult than New York.

What is the most famous marathon in the world?

  1. Boston Marathon (April) Marathon statistics show one of the most famous marathons for runners worldwide is also one of the oldest. Inspired by the revival of the marathon in the 1896 Olympics, the first Boston Marathon was run in 1897.

What is the hardest marathon in the world?

On Erik’s Adventures’ Inca Peninsula Marathon website, they tout this race as “A Marathon in Distance but an Ultra in Effort.” Many would agree that the Inca Peninsula Marathon is the most difficult marathon in the world. Mostly paved in 500-year-old Inca stone, the trail is 4-6 feet wide and is treacherous.
